Understanding Earthquakes and Tremors

Firstly, guys, let's get a basic understanding of what an earthquake and a tremor are. Essentially, a tremor is a less intense version of an earthquake. Both are caused by the release of energy in the Earth's crust, but the scale of the energy release is what differentiates them. Earthquakes are often associated with significant ground shaking, potential structural damage, and sometimes, even tsunamis. On the other hand, tremors, though still noticeable, usually involve a milder shaking that is less likely to cause damage. It's important to note that even small tremors can be felt, and their frequency and location can provide scientists with valuable data about the geological activity in a region. So, whenever the earth starts to rumble, whether it's a full-blown earthquake or a little tremor, scientists and the community pay close attention.

Now, what exactly causes these tremors? The answer often lies in tectonic plates. The Earth's crust is made up of several large plates that are constantly moving, albeit very slowly. These plates can collide, slide past each other, or even pull apart. When these movements occur, stress builds up within the rocks. When this stress exceeds the strength of the rocks, they break, releasing energy in the form of seismic waves – and this is what we feel as an earthquake or a tremor. While Brisbane isn't located directly on a major fault line like some other areas around the world (California, for example), it still experiences tremors. These are frequently related to smaller, localized fault lines or adjustments within the Earth's crust. Additionally, human activities, like mining operations, can also sometimes contribute to tremors, although this is usually not the primary cause. It is important to note that any tremor or earthquake is a natural event, and understanding their causes helps us better prepare for them and respond appropriately.

When a tremor occurs, the impact depends on a few key factors. The magnitude, which measures the energy released by the tremor, is a crucial factor. The location of the tremor, and how far away you are from the epicenter, also affects how strong the shaking feels. For example, a tremor that occurs directly beneath your feet will likely feel more intense than one that happens miles away. The geology of the area also plays a role; areas with softer soil may experience more amplified shaking compared to areas with solid bedrock. Potential Causes of Tremors in Brisbane

Let's get into the nitty-gritty of why Brisbane might be experiencing a tremor today. While Brisbane isn't located on a major fault line like some other parts of the world, there are still several potential causes for seismic activity in the area. One of the primary culprits is, as mentioned earlier, localized fault lines. These are smaller faults compared to the ones that create massive earthquakes, but they can still produce tremors as the tectonic plates adjust and release energy. The geological makeup of Queensland, including Brisbane, involves a complex network of faults, and these can be sources of seismic activity. The movement and interaction of these faults are usually the primary cause of tremors in the region. Scientists monitor these faults to better understand the risk and improve preparedness.

Another contributing factor can be human activities, although, in the case of Brisbane, they are less likely than natural geological activity. Mining operations, for example, involve the extraction of resources from the earth. These activities can, in some cases, trigger minor tremors. This is because removing large amounts of material from underground can alter the stress on the surrounding rocks, leading to small-scale seismic events. Similarly, other industrial activities that involve ground disturbance could also contribute. It's important to note that any tremors linked to human activities are typically minor and less frequent compared to those caused by natural processes. What to Do If You Feel a Tremor

So, what do you do if you feel the ground shake in Brisbane today? It's easy to get a little panicked during a tremor. First of all, guys, the most important thing is to stay calm. Panicking will not help, so try to take a deep breath and assess the situation. Then, the first step is to recognize that you're feeling a tremor. If you are indoors, the most recommended action is to drop to the floor, cover your head and neck, and hold on to something sturdy. This protective position is designed to shield you from falling objects and debris. If there's a sturdy table or desk nearby, get under it. Otherwise, find a wall or corner, and cover your head with your arms. These actions are based on safety guidelines and are the most effective way to reduce the risk of injury during a tremor.

If you're outdoors, move away from buildings, power lines, and anything else that could fall. Stay in an open area, and continue to be aware of your surroundings. If you're in a car, pull over to the side of the road and stay inside until the shaking stops. Once the shaking has stopped, it's essential to take further steps to ensure your safety and well-being. Check for any injuries, and provide first aid if needed. Check your surroundings for any hazards, such as fallen power lines or damaged buildings. If you're unsure about the safety of your building, evacuate and seek shelter in a safe location. This is especially important if you notice visible structural damage or if you smell gas. Remember, safety is the priority in any situation.

After the tremor, it's also important to stay informed. Listen to local news and follow official instructions from authorities. They will provide important information about the tremor, any potential aftershocks, and any advice or warnings to stay safe. Check your home for any damage. Look for cracks in the walls, damage to your foundation, or any other structural issues. If you suspect damage, contact a qualified professional to assess the safety of your home. Be prepared for any aftershocks, which can occur after the main tremor. Aftershocks are usually less intense than the main tremor, but they can still cause damage. Be ready to drop, cover, and hold on during any aftershocks. Finally, review your emergency plan and update your emergency kit. Ensure you have essential supplies, such as water, food, a first-aid kit, and a flashlight. Being prepared can go a long way in helping you manage the situation and ensuring your safety. Long-Term Preparedness and Safety Measures

While knowing what to do during a Brisbane tremor today is essential, it's also important to think about long-term preparedness and safety measures. This involves taking steps to ensure you and your family are ready for future seismic events. The first thing to consider is building a comprehensive emergency plan. This plan should include identifying a safe meeting place, establishing communication protocols, and creating an emergency kit. Ensure that all family members are aware of the plan and know what to do in case of an emergency. Having a well-defined plan reduces confusion and ensures that everyone knows what to do during a tremor. Practicing the plan regularly helps reinforce the guidelines and ensures everyone is familiar with the plan.

Next, you should prepare an emergency kit. This kit should include essential supplies, such as water, non-perishable food, a first-aid kit, a flashlight, a battery-powered or hand-crank radio, extra batteries, and any necessary medications. Make sure you have enough supplies to last for several days. Keep the kit in an easily accessible location, and ensure that all family members know where it is. Regularly check your kit to ensure the items are still in good condition. Moreover, consider earthquake-proofing your home. This can involve securing heavy furniture, such as bookshelves and cabinets, to the walls. You can also install latches on cabinets to prevent items from falling out during a tremor. Consider other safety measures, such as reinforcing your home's structure if you live in an area prone to seismic activity. Regularly inspecting your home for any structural issues will help you be proactive in addressing them. By taking these steps, you can reduce the risk of injuries and damage during an earthquake.

It's also essential to be aware of your surroundings and the hazards that may exist in your home or workplace. For example, you might want to identify potential hazards like unstable items or objects that could fall on you. During an earthquake, unsecured objects can become deadly missiles, so securing anything that could fall is a crucial precaution.
